Anise Star Essential Oil


Average Product Rating: 5 / 5 (Based on 13 Customer Reviews)



Botanical Name: Illicium verum

Plant Part: Seeds

Extraction Method: Steam Distilled

Origin: China

Description: A small to medium evergreen tree of the magnolia family, reaching up to 8m (26ft). The leaves are lanceolate and the axillary flowers are yellow. The fruits are harvested before they ripen, then sun dried. It is, as the name suggests, star shaped, radiating between five and ten pointed boat-shaped sections, about eight on average. These hard sections are seedpods. Tough skinned and rust colored, they measure up to 3cm (1-1/4”) long.

Color: Colorless to pale yellow liquid.

Common Uses: Anise Star Essential Oil has carminative, stomachic, stimulant and diuretic properties. In the East it is used to combat colic and rheumatism.

Consistency: Light

Note: Top

Strength of Aroma: Strong

Blends well with: Lavender, Pine, Orange, Rosewood, Clove, and Cinnamon.

Aromatic Scent: Anise Star has a powerful and licorice-like scent.

History: Anise Star is often chewed in small quantities after each meal to promote digestion and sweeten the breath. The Japanese plant the tree in their temples and on tombs; and use the pounded bark as incense. Homeopaths can prepare tinctures from the seeds.

Cautions: Anise Star is generally non-toxic and non-irritating (unlike Illicium anisatum the Japanese variety that is long considered toxic).
